Federal politics has returned to Canberra for the first time since the May election with reforms to student loans/HELP debts the first thing to hit parliament. The 20-percent reduction is a welcome change for the three million Australians managing a student debt.
But is this the first change of many, or the last we can expect for a while?
We take a look at how the nation and the world has benefited from fee-free university, and what can be done to ease the burden on graduates forced to grapple with cost-of-living pressures.
